神秘代码在现代社会中扮演着多种角色,从简单的加密到复杂的算法,它们在信息安全、编程、密码学等领域发挥着至关重要的作用。本文将深入探讨神秘代码mr4845382背后的秘密,分析其可能的用途、构成以及可能的安全风险。
一、神秘代码的构成分析
1. 字符串结构
首先,我们观察到mr4845382是一个由数字和字母组成的字符串。这种组合常见于密码、密钥或者特定的编码系统。以下是对其结构的初步分析:
mr4845382
包含8个字符。- 字符串的前两个字符为小写字母,其余为数字。
2. 可能的编码方式
基于上述结构,以下是一些可能的编码方式:
- ASCII编码:检查字符串是否对应于特定的ASCII编码字符。
- Base64编码:检查字符串是否可以解码为有效的Base64数据。
- 十六进制编码:将字符串转换为十六进制,检查是否有特定的数据含义。
二、神秘代码的应用场景
1. 加密与安全
神秘代码mr4845382可能是一个加密密钥或者安全认证的一部分。在网络安全领域,类似的代码用于保护数据传输和存储。
2. 编程与算法
在编程中,这样的代码可能是一个特殊的变量名、函数名或者是一个算法的一部分。例如,它可能是一个特定的常量,用于控制某个程序的逻辑。
3. 密码学
在密码学中,这样的代码可能是一个密钥,用于加密或解密信息。
三、神秘代码的潜在风险
1. 信息泄露
如果mr4845382是一个密钥或密码,泄露它可能导致相关数据的安全风险。
2. 恶意利用
恶意软件或黑客可能会利用这样的代码进行攻击,例如通过恶意代码注入。
四、案例分析
以下是一个简化的案例,展示如何尝试解码mr4845382:
# Python示例代码,用于尝试解码mr4845382
import base64
# 假设mr4845382是一个Base64编码的字符串
encoded_str = "mr4845382"
# 尝试解码
try:
decoded_bytes = base64.b64decode(encoded_str)
decoded_str = decoded_bytes.decode('utf-8')
print("解码结果:", decoded_str)
except Exception as e:
print("解码失败:", e)
五、结论
mr4845382是一个具有多种可能性的神秘代码。通过分析其构成、应用场景和潜在风险,我们可以更好地理解其在不同领域的潜在作用。然而,要完全揭示其背后的秘密,可能需要更多的上下文信息和专业知识。